Ziad Musallam and Jan Burkhard - Discuss Elmira/Burlington
Project and Review Sewer Use Draft Resolution
|
Mr. Musallam presented a draft resolution of
sewer regulations and uses for the county. He reviewed it
briefly, hitting the highlights of the resolution for discussion
purposes. It started with definitions taken from the Clearwater
Act. Article II covered use of public sewers required. Article
III - building sewers and connections. Section 2 under Article
III drew discussion over requirement of a license in order to do
sewer taps. Five years experience would be required in order to
obtain a license. Mr. Musallam stressed that this could assure
that the taps are done right. Yearly license fees were not
something the Commissioners felt comfortable with. Performance
bonds could be required for certain jobs in lieu of this
licensing. Commissioners Graf and Genter both said they were
against licensing. Mr. Musallam agreed to take that out of the
resolution. Article IV - use of public sewers. Article V -
control of industrial wastes. Article VI - protection from
damage. Article VII - powers and authority of inspection.
Article VIII - penalties. Article IX - validity. Article X -
resolution in force. With regards to penalties, Commissioner
Graf asked the question if they as Commissioners have authority
by Statute to impose fines. Mr. Musallam said he believes that
they do because of damages. Commissioner Graf thought the
resolution ought to state that specifically and that a person
would be assessed individually for any damages. Commissioner
Genter agreed. If it is allowable by Statute then that authority
should be specified in the resolution. That section 2 will be
looked at further. Mr. Musallam stressed that this is not a
final resolution but only a draft. Commissioner Graf cautioned
Mr. Musallam that the Commissioners are not governed the same as
municipalities. Mr. Musallam will work on it and will present it
at a later date, possibly Thursday. Legal counsel will be sought
as well. Mr. Hall said he did not see any need to rush. Eastman
& Smith was one suggestion.

Ziad Musallam - outstanding issues from last week |
Mr. Musallam informed the Commissioners that the
EPA is now saying they will allow leachate from the landfill to
be hauled to the Pettisville lagoon with a special permit. Cost
will be researched by Mr. Musallam before taking any action.
Northeast Fulton County water supply - Mr. Musallam has spoken
with Congressman Gillmor and Senator DeWine for possibility of
funding. The EPA could stand in between obtaining federal
funding. Mr. Musallam will preceed with the grant application.
